Latest Patents
Edwards holds a patent for a bioprocess container, which includes a bioprocess container mixing device and method of use. This invention features a flexible container placed inside a heat exchanger. The design allows for a disposable agitation device to be used inside the sealed container, enabling stirring without the need to open it. The agitation elements can include traditional stirrers, rotating magnetic rods, and bladder devices that are integral to the container's structure. Additionally, a containment disk is utilized to ensure that the magnetic rod remains within the magnetic field. He has 1 patent to his name.
